Key Responsibilities
- Teach: Conduct one-on-one and group English language training sessions with employees.
- Design: Develop customized lesson plans and learning materials tailored to the team’s needs.
- Coach: Support employees in improving grammar, vocabulary, pronunciation, and accent clarity, while introducing relevant tech and CRO terminology.
- Facilitate: Lead workshops on English Grammar, communication skills, including presentations and public speaking.
- Assess & Evaluate: Track learner progress, provide learning assessments and evaluations as needed, adapt teaching methods, and share weekly progress reports.
- Plan, Schedule & Collaborate: Prepare weekly lesson plans, schedule and reschedule lessons as needed, maintain reliable delivery of sessions, and collaborate with HR and department heads to address training needs.
- Demonstrate Independence & Reliability: Take ownership of your responsibilities, work autonomously, and consistently deliver with professionalism in teaching, planning, reporting, and employee interactions.
Skills, Knowledge and Experience
- Education: Bachelor’s degree in English, Education, or a related field.
- Experience: Minimum of 2–3 years as an ESL instructor, preferably teaching students in Eastern Europe or Asia. Experience working on employee development projects or with an HR background is a plus.
- Fluency: Excellent command of written and spoken English (CEFR C2-level or equivalent).
- Professionalism: Independent, accountable, and consistently demonstrates professionalism.
- People Skills: Strong interpersonal and relationship-building abilities.
- Creativity & Adaptability: Ability to design engaging learning materials, provide feedback, and tailor teaching methods to different learning styles.
- Attention to Detail & Curiosity: Keen eye for detail and a willingness to learn beyond English teaching, including navigating the CRO/tech environment.
- Growth Mindset: Strong desire for self-development and continuous learning
- Bonus Skills: Experience teaching presentations/public speaking and familiarity with basic web development terminology (e.g., HTML).
- 40 hours per week, with partial overlap with Eastern Standard Time until 1 ET. Flexibility is required to accommodate learners’ schedules as needed.

Working in Serbia
Serbia, officially the Republic of Serbia, is a landlocked country in Southeast and Central Europe. Located in the Balkans, it is bordered by Hungary in the north, Romania in the northeast, Bulgaria in the southeast, North Macedonia in the south, Croatia in the northwest, Bosnia and Herzegovina in the west, and Montenegro in the southwest. Serbia also claims to share a border with Albania through the disputed territory of Kosovo. Serbia has about 6.6 million inhabitants, excluding Kosovo. Belgrade, Serbia's capital, is also its largest city.
